此为 Mathematica 4 文档,内容基于更早版本的 Wolfram 语言
查看最新文档(版本11.1)

DumpSave

Usage

DumpSave["file.mx", symbol] 用于把与一个符号相关的定义以内部Mathematica格式写入一个文件.
DumpSave["file.mx", "context`"]用于写出与指定上下文中所有符号都相关的定义.
DumpSave["file.mx",   ,  , ...  ] 用于写出多个符号或上下文的定义.
DumpSave["package`", objects]用来选择基于所使用的计算机系统的输出文件名 .
DumpSave["file"] 用来保存当前对话中的所有定义.


Notes

DumpSave 以二进制格式写出定义,该格式是 Mathematica使用的最佳输入格式.
• 每一个文件都有一个无格式的文本,用于指定它的类型和内容. • DumpSave生成的文件能使用Get读出.
DumpSave生成的文件只有在与生成它的计算机系统类型相同的系统上才能被读出.
DumpSave不会保存开放的流和连接对象.
DumpSave生成的文件的文件名通常以 .mx结尾.
DumpSave["package`", ... ]生成一个名称为诸如 package.mx/$SystemID/package.mx.之类的文件.
• 可以使用 DumpSave["file", "s"]来输出一个符号 s 自身的值的定义.
DumpSave["file"]将保存当前会话中所有符号的定义.
• 当使用初始文件命令行可选项启动Mathematica时,通常可以读出一个卸除文件.
• 参见Mathematica 全书: 2.11.1节.
• 同时参见: Save, LinkWrite.